V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
jomsou
V2EX  ›  React

react (react hooks 写法) + typescript + antd + vite2/webpack5 后台管理系统模板

  •  
  •   jomsou · 2021-08-12 16:12:15 +08:00 · 2883 次点击
    这是一个创建于 1192 天前的主题,其中的信息可能已经有所发展或是发生改变。

    最近在忙着后台系统的重构,写了个模板,欢迎使用,觉得不错可以 star 支持下,谢谢~~,有问题欢迎提交 issues 交流。

    仓库地址

    https://github.com/zenquan/react-admin-template.git

    预览

    预览地址

    账号数据

    • 管理员 admin admin
    • 运营 zenquan zenquan

    技术栈

    react^17 + react-router-dom^4 + less + css modules + antd^4 + axios + mobx + echarts + react-i18next

    开始

    # git clone
    git clone https://github.com/zenquan/react-admin-template.git
    or
    git clone -b <branch> https://github.com/zenquan/react-admin-template.git
    
    # install
    npm install
    
    # start or dev
    master or master-i18n -> npm run start
    vite or vite-i18n -> npm run dev
    
    

    功能、组件的封装

    • 系统首页
    • 表格
      • 可编辑行表格
      • 拖拽排序表格
    • 图表
      • 折线图
      • 饼图
    • 组件
      • 富文本编辑器
      • Markdown
      • JSON 编辑器
    • Excel
      • 导出 excel
    • 404 页
    • 国际化

    分支

    • webpack5: [ master 分支]
    • webpack5 国际化: [ master-i18n 分支]
    • vite: [ vite 分支]
    • vite 国际化: [ vite-i18 分支]
    19 条回复    2021-08-13 13:24:22 +08:00
    ccyu220
        1
    ccyu220  
       2021-08-12 16:34:06 +08:00   ❤️ 1
    太简陋,入门级的 admin,没有亮点啊
    andyskaura
        2
    andyskaura  
       2021-08-12 16:52:25 +08:00
    前段时间还有个群友发了个开源项目 欢迎 star
    andyskaura
        3
    andyskaura  
       2021-08-12 16:53:02 +08:00   ❤️ 1
    https://github.com/Caladog/cala-react 跟你这有得一拼 也不知道开了个啥
    Valid
        4
    Valid  
       2021-08-12 17:08:06 +08:00   ❤️ 1
    我为什么不用 antd pro?
    Haulk
        5
    Haulk  
       2021-08-12 17:43:43 +08:00
    登录了还能回到 login 页?
    jomsou
        6
    jomsou  
    OP
       2021-08-12 17:49:43 +08:00
    @Haulk 点击头像可以退出登录的
    jomsou
        7
    jomsou  
    OP
       2021-08-12 17:52:21 +08:00
    @Valid antd pro 很全很好,但是有的时候业务不需要那么多东西,而且这也是一个自己从零开始搭建学习的项目和过程
    XTTX
        8
    XTTX  
       2021-08-12 18:25:29 +08:00
    建议上一些 tailwindcss 这种 css kit,换 material ui 也挺好的。
    jomsou
        9
    jomsou  
    OP
       2021-08-12 18:50:07 +08:00
    @XTTX hhh,确实上点这个会好看一些
    XTTX
        10
    XTTX  
       2021-08-12 19:00:22 +08:00
    @jomsou 有闲钱可以买 tailwind 作者的做好的组建包,省事
    XTTX
        11
    XTTX  
       2021-08-12 19:03:04 +08:00
    有也免费的 tailwind-kit.com
    iwasthere
        12
    iwasthere  
       2021-08-12 20:44:15 +08:00 via iPhone
    @Valid 挺好用的,省了不少代码
    jomsou
        13
    jomsou  
    OP
       2021-08-12 21:48:02 +08:00
    @XTTX nice,感谢推荐~~
    XTTX
        14
    XTTX  
       2021-08-12 21:57:26 +08:00
    @jomsou tailwind 除了第一次 setup 有点麻烦,用起来挺方便的。 你看看官网的 doc 。 对比 https://github.com/jt6677/miller_columns 里面的 tailwind.config.js craco.config.js 。
    jomsou
        15
    jomsou  
    OP
       2021-08-12 22:13:49 +08:00
    @XTTX 好的,我看看,感谢👍🏼
    Valid
        16
    Valid  
       2021-08-12 22:46:36 +08:00
    @XTTX 这个把 tailwind 的精髓都弄没了,tailwind 应用最好的应该还是 stripe
    XTTX
        17
    XTTX  
       2021-08-13 08:25:15 +08:00
    @Valid 你说的 tailwind 精髓是什么?
    Valid
        18
    Valid  
       2021-08-13 12:22:16 +08:00
    @XTTX 设计上的精髓
    XTTX
        19
    XTTX  
       2021-08-13 13:24:22 +08:00
    @Valid Tailwind UI 是 tailwindcss 作者自己写的收费 UI 组件。tailwind 设计的精髓已经在预先写好的各种大小和颜色里了。
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   2765 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 26ms · UTC 12:32 · PVG 20:32 · LAX 04:32 · JFK 07:32
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.